PS: 該部分內容從理論上分析浮點數的算術標准應該如何制定,不要與IEEE754標准混淆 為什么要討論浮點數在計算機中如何表示? 定點數表示會導致許多前導0,浪費空間。 定點數表示范圍小,運算困難。 浮點數的表示 浮點數 = 尾數*階碼的基階碼的值 200.1 ...
人類世界的小數的表示形式 我們最習慣的小數表示形式是十進制,形式為: 它的值為: 小數的二進制表示法,形式為: 它的值為: IEEE浮點標准 在計算機系統中,因為有字節的限制 C語言中float類型占 字節,double類型占 字節 ,小數的表示要復雜的多。IEEE制定的浮點標准得到了所有的計算機的支持。 IEEE浮點標准用如下形式表示一個數: 符號 sign s, 為負數, 為正數。數值 的符號 ...
2013-04-08 10:16 3 2697 推薦指數:
PS: 該部分內容從理論上分析浮點數的算術標准應該如何制定,不要與IEEE754標准混淆 為什么要討論浮點數在計算機中如何表示? 定點數表示會導致許多前導0,浪費空間。 定點數表示范圍小,運算困難。 浮點數的表示 浮點數 = 尾數*階碼的基階碼的值 200.1 ...
上一篇博客我們講解了二進制小數如何表示以及IEEE浮點標准。而且我們也提到過因為這種表示方法限制了浮點數的范圍和精度,浮點數只能近似的表示一個數。 比如 數字1/5,我們能用十進制小數 0.2 准確的表示,但是我們卻不能把它准確的表示為一個二進制小數,我們只能通過增加二進制表示的長度 ...
2019年9月22日 題目2.88 答案 格式A 格式B 位 值 位 值 ...
前言 上一章我們簡單介紹了IEEE浮點標准,本次我們主要講解一下浮點運算舍入的問題,以及簡單的介紹浮點數的運算。 之前我們已經提到過,有很多小數是二進制浮點數無法准確表示的,因此就難免會遇到舍入的問題。這一點其實在我們平時的計算當中會經常出現,就比如之前我們提到過的0.3,它就 ...
2.6我們進行了二進制整數運算的最后一役,本次LZ將和各位一起進入浮點數的世界,這里沒有無符號,沒有補碼,但是有各種各樣的驚奇。倘若你真正的進入了浮點數的世界,一定會發現它原來是這么有意思,而不是像之前一樣,覺得了解浮點數的內容沒什么用,只要會簡單的使用就行了。當然,這其中也可能有部分猿友 ...
一、簡述 1.1 計算機底層存儲數據的基本原理 計算機要處理的信息是多種多樣的,如數字、文字、符號、圖形、音頻、視頻等,這些信息在人們的眼里是不同的。但對於計算機來說,它們在內存中都是一樣的,都是以二進制的形式來表示。要想學習編程,就必須了解二進制,它是計算機處理數據的基礎。 內存條 ...
話題:浮點數在計算機中是如何表示的? 回答:浮點數 浮點數是屬於有理數中某特定子集的數的數字表示,在計算機中用以近似表示任意某個實數。具體的說,這個實數由一個整數或定點數(即尾數)乘以某個基數(計算機中通常是2) 話題:浮點數的解釋 回答:浮點數是屬於有理數中某特定子集的數的數字 ...
前言 相比int等整型,float等浮點類型的表示和存儲較為復雜,但它又是一個無法回避的話題,那么就有必要對浮點一探究竟了。在計算機中,一般用IEEE浮點近似表示任意一個實數,那么它實際上又是如何表示的呢? 下面的表達式里,i的值是多少,為什么?如果你不確定答案,那么你應該好好看看本文 ...